Abstract
Inflammatory bowel disease (IBD) is a chronic immune-mediated disorder of the gastrointestinal tract that is frequently associated with neuropsychiatric comorbidities, such as anxiety, depression, and other neurological disorders. Accumulating evidence suggests that these neuropsychiatric disorders are secondary conditions caused by impaired gut-brain communication. The gut-brain axis connects the gut and the brain via neural, endocrine, and immune signaling pathways, disruption of which is usually caused by intestinal microbiota imbalance, intestinal barrier damage, neuroinflammation and immune activation, and neuroendocrine pathway abnormalities. These pathways constitute the pathological basis of the disease spectrum of neuropsychiatric comorbidities in IBD patients. This article comprehensively reviews the core mechanisms and disease spectrum of gut-brain axis-mediated neurological and mental complications in IBD, and discusses potential therapeutic strategies and challenges.
